6100/200 System
Memory Update
Y
our Dell PowerEdge 6100/200 system now supports
up to 4 gigabytes (GB) of memory using 128-megabyte
(MB) dual in-line memory modules (DIMMs). This doc-
ument describes operating system requirements and the
process of installing and removing the 4-GB memory
module.

System Memory
Requirements
The following subsections address the memory require-
ments for the Microsoft
®
Windows NT
®
4.0 and 3.51
operating systems and for the Novell
®
NetWare
®
4.xx
and 3.12 operating systems.
Windows NT 4.0 and 3.51
The Windows NT 4.0 operating system requires the
installation of the Microsoft Service Pack 2 or higher;
however, you cannot install this Service Pack on a system
with more than 2 GB of memory. Before you install Ser-
vice Pack 2 or higher, you must remove all DIMMs that
provide more than 2 GB of memory. After installing the
Service Pack, you can install the additional memory.
The Microsoft Service Pack 5 is recommended for the
Windows NT 3.51 operating system if you want to install
more than 2 GB of memory. You can install Service
Pack 5 on a system with more than 2 GB of memory.
Novell NetWare 4.xx
If your system has more than 3 GB of memory, you must
update the server.exe file to the latest version of Support
Pack for Novell NetWare 4.xx.
NOTE: You must remove all DIMMs that provide more
than 3 GB to properly install or update a Novell NetWare
Support Pack. After installing or updating the operating
system and Support Pack, you can replace the additional
memory.
For instructions on installing Support Pack 3.0A on
Novell NetWare 4.11, see “Installing the Dell-Supported
Novell Patches” in the Novell NetWare 4.11 Technical
Update.
For instructions on installing Support Packs on earlier
versions of NetWare, see the iwsp2.txt file in the iwsp2
directory on the Dell IntranetWare Support CD.
Novell NetWare 3.12
The Novell NetWare 3.12 operating system supports
more than 3 GB of memory. Dell recommends that you
update the NetWare operating system along with the
loader.exe file to the most recent version. See the Novell
World Wide Web site, http://support.novell.com. The
file is named 312PTx.exe, where x is the latest version
available.
After you install all the patches, use the register memory
console command so the operating system will recognize
the additional memory.

Memory
The 4-GB memory module has 32 DIMM sockets and a
capacity of 0.5 GB to 4 GB, increased in 0.5-GB incre-
ments. You can upgrade the computer system to 4 GB by
installing 128-MB DIMMs, which should be rated at
60 nanoseconds (ns). The memory upgrade kits can be
purchased from Dell as needed.
